Masters of gestures Familie Flöz are returning to Prague
After a three-year break, he entered the theater space Slaughterhouse78 return Familie Flöz, the famous mask theater, which, with its distinctive mastery, releases halls all over the world. The new FESTE will be launched in Prague only three times, and only from November 24 to 26.
As is typical for the ensemble, here again he crosses all language barriers. Expressive, delicate masks and virtuoso physical theater they discuss the complexity of the world of our day; from climate change to the growing problem between wealth and poverty to the unstoppable progress that dominates us. Familie Flöz will transport the Prague audience without words into a poetic one a mixture of bitter tragedy and dark grotesque to a lavish mansion by the sea, where preparations are underway for the wedding. “This is a very simple story that tells about the complexity of today’s world. It deals with the climate crisis, for example, and the ever-widening gap between the rich and the poor,” says one of the creators and actors, Thomas van Ouwerkerk. In addition to him, actors Andres Angulo and Johannes Stubenvoll will perform on stage. Their pantomime performances only illustrate sounds and music.
Familie Flöz roams the world stage with a show of incredible poetry, born from a combination of commedia dell’arte and German expressionism. Since its foundation in 1994, the international group of artists has already performed in 43 countries around the world.
Familie Flöz from its repertoire of performances in the Holešovice 78m space Hotel Paradiso, Infinita and Teatro Delusio, which together were visited by almost 4,000 spectators. Familie Flöz fans as well as viewers who do not yet know the unusual artists can look forward to the incredible liveliness of the masks, the lightning-fast transformations and the melancholic mood of this famous physical theater.
